Best Spots for Trout Fishing

The Davidson River is home to several prime fishing spots. Each location offers unique experiences and challenges for anglers of all skill levels.

  1. Avery Creek Avery Creek is a serene spot where the waters are calm and the trout are plentiful. The creek's clear waters make it easy to spot fish, and the surrounding forest provides a peaceful backdrop.

  2. Looking Glass Creek This creek is known for its picturesque scenery and abundant trout. The water is cool and clear, making it a perfect spot for fly fishing. The creek's rocky bed provides excellent hiding spots for trout.

  3. Sycamore Flats Located near the entrance of the Pisgah National Forest, Sycamore Flats offers easy access and a variety of fishing opportunities. The area is well-stocked with trout, and the wide, shallow waters are ideal for wading.

Lesser-Known Fishing Holes

While the main spots are popular, there are several lesser-known locations that offer equally rewarding fishing experiences.

  1. Daniel Ridge Creek Tucked away in a more remote area, Daniel Ridge Creek is a hidden gem. The creek's secluded location means fewer anglers and more opportunities to catch trout. The surrounding trails also offer great hiking.

  2. Cathey's Creek This small, quiet creek is perfect for those looking to escape the crowds. The waters are teeming with trout, and the lush vegetation provides plenty of shade and cover.

  3. Coon Tree Picnic Area This spot is not just for picnicking. The nearby stream is a fantastic place for trout fishing. The area is less crowded, making it a peaceful spot to cast a line.

Tips for a Successful Fishing Trip

To make the most of your fishing trip, consider these tips:

  • Early Morning Fishing: Trout are most active in the early morning. Arrive early to increase your chances of a good catch.
  • Proper Gear: Use light tackle and small flies or lures to mimic the insects trout feed on.
  • Stay Stealthy: Trout are easily spooked. Move slowly and quietly to avoid scaring them away.

Enjoying the Surroundings

The Davidson River area is not just about fishing. The natural beauty and recreational opportunities make it a great destination for outdoor enthusiasts.

  1. Pisgah National Forest The forest surrounding the Davidson River offers hiking, camping, and wildlife watching. The trails range from easy walks to challenging hikes, providing something for everyone.

  2. Sliding Rock A natural water slide, Sliding Rock is a fun spot to cool off after a day of fishing. The smooth rock and cool water make it a popular spot for families.

  3. Cradle of Forestry Learn about the history of forestry in America at this educational site. The Cradle of Forestry offers exhibits, trails, and interactive displays that are both fun and informative.
